Trimuhan has a population of 3288 as recorded in the 2011 Census. It falls under the jurisdiction of Trimuhan Gram Panchayat and the Ghoswari Block Panchayat in Ghoswari District. The village has 470 households and is identified by village code 246524. Trimuhan is located in the 803302 postal area, contributing significantly to the rural administrative structure of Ghoswari Sub-District.
Total Population of Trimuhan
As of the 2011 census, Population of Trimuhan has a population of approximately 3288 people, where the male population is 1767 and the female population is 1521.

Household in Trimuhan
There are approximately 470 households in Trimuhan. The average household size in the village is about 7 persons per house.
